President Bola Tinubu on Thursday presided over the meeting of the Council of State, with former Heads of State Ibrahim Babangida and Abdulsalami Abubakar attending virtually.

‎The News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) reports that Tinubu arrived at the Council Chambers of the Presidential Villa,  at exactly 1:29 p.m. for the hybrid meeting, which convened both physical and virtual participants.

‎NAN reports that the Council of State includes all surviving former Presidents and Heads of State, the Vice President, and serving and retired Chief Justices of the Supreme Court.

This marks Tinubu’s second Council of State meeting since assuming office, following the first session held in August 2024.

‎In attendance were Vice President Kashim Shettima, Senate President Godswill Akpabio, and House Speaker Tajudeen Abbas.

‎Also present were Secretary to the Government of the Federation George Akume and Minister of Justice and Attorney General of the Federation Lateef  Fagbemi.

‎Others are the National Security Adviser  (NSA) Nuhu Ribadu and Chief of Staff Femi Gbajabiamila, alongside several serving governors.

Former Chief Justices present included Muhammad Tanko, Mohammed Belgore, and Walter Onnoghen.

‎The meeting is expected to focus on pressing national security matters and preparations for the 2027 general elections
